Boating BC is the voice of recreational boating in British Columbia & host of the annual Vancouver International Boat Show.

The Boating BC Association has been the voice of recreational boating in BC since 1957, working with all levels of government and other stakeholders to grow and enhance the boating experience, including: promotion of recreational boating; delivery of member services and benefits; advocacy on industry issues; and support for environmental stewardship.
